Hoe maak je een Git Merge ongedaan: Een praktische gids
Deze gids biedt praktische stappen voor het ongedaan maken van een Git-merge, zodat uw versiebeheerproces efficiënt en foutloos verloopt.
Wat is How to Undo a Git Merge: A Practical Guide?
Deze gids richt zich op de verschillende methoden om effectief een Git-merge ongedaan te maken, wat een veelvoorkomend scenario is in versiebeheer wanneer u wijzigingen moet terugdraaien die per ongeluk zijn samengevoegd. Het begrijpen van hoe u een Git-merge ongedaan kunt maken, is essentieel voor het behouden van een schone projectgeschiedenis en ervoor zorgen dat uw codebasis stabiel blijft.
Het begrijpen van Git Merge
Een Git-merge combineert wijzigingen van verschillende branches. Soms kan een merge echter conflicten of ongewenste wijzigingen introduceren. Weten hoe u een merge ongedaan kunt maken, stelt ontwikkelaars in staat terug te keren naar een eerdere staat zonder belangrijk werk te verliezen. Deze gids zal de veelvoorkomende scenario's en commando's verkennen die betrokken zijn bij het ongedaan maken van een Git-merge.
Waarom een Git Merge ongedaan maken?
Het ongedaan maken van een Git-merge helpt de integriteit van uw code te behouden. Of het nu gaat om conflicten of een onjuiste merge, het begrijpen van dit proces is cruciaal voor effectief versiebeheer. Dit zorgt ervoor dat het repository schoon en functioneel blijft, waardoor verstoringen in ontwikkelingsworkflows worden geminimaliseerd.
Veelvoorkomende methoden om een Git Merge ongedaan te maken
Er zijn verschillende methoden om een Git-merge ongedaan te maken, waaronder:
- Gebruik van Git Reset: Met dit commando kunt u uw branch resetten naar een eerdere commit, waardoor de merge ongedaan wordt gemaakt.
- Gebruik van Git Checkout: Deze methode houdt in dat u een specifieke commit uitcheckt vóór de merge.
- Gebruik van Git Revert: Dit commando maakt een nieuwe commit aan die de wijzigingen van de merge ongedaan maakt.
Best Practices voor versiebeheer
Een gestructureerde aanpak voor versiebeheer handhaven kan de noodzaak van frequente ongedaanmakingen voorkomen. Regelmatige commits, duidelijke branching-strategieën en effectieve communicatie binnen teams zijn essentieel.
Laatste gedachten
Het begrijpen van hoe u een Git-merge ongedaan kunt maken, is essentieel voor elke ontwikkelaar die met versiebeheersystemen werkt. Het zorgt ervoor dat u uw code efficiënt kunt beheren en naadloos kunt herstellen van fouten. Voor meer inzichten in best practices voor versiebeheer, overweeg het verkennen van geavanceerde Git-technieken.
FAQ over het ongedaan maken van Git-merges
Wat is een Git-merge?
Een Git-merge is een commando dat wijzigingen van de ene branch integreert in een andere.
Waarom zou ik een Git-merge moeten ongedaan maken?
U moet een Git-merge ongedaan maken als deze conflicten of ongewenste wijzigingen introduceert.
Welke commando's kan ik gebruiken om een merge ongedaan te maken?
U kunt commando's zoals Git reset, Git checkout en Git revert gebruiken om een merge ongedaan te maken.
Zal ik mijn wijzigingen verliezen als ik een merge ongedaan maak?
Niet per se; het hangt af van de gebruikte methode. Git revert maakt een nieuwe commit aan die eerdere wijzigingen ongedaan maakt.
Is er een manier om te herstellen van een slechte merge?
Ja, met behulp van Git's reset- of revert-commando's kunt u herstellen van een slechte merge.
Hoe snel is uw website?
Verhoog de snelheid en SEO naadloos met onze gratis snelheidstest.Je verdient betere testdiensten
Versterk je digitale ervaring! Uitgebreide en gebruiksvriendelijke cloudplatform voor Load en Speed Testing en Monitoring.Begin nu met testen→